Hi all,

hba1c on diagnosis = 12.9
hba1c @ 3 months = 10
hba1c @ 6 months = 9.8
hba1c @ 12 months = 9.6

All above on MDI (very insulin sensitive and couldnt get it any lower so offered pump).


Hba1c's since using pump for 1 year.

hab1c @ 2 months = 7.1
hba1c @ 6 months = 7.4


and todays hba1c..........................................................................
..................................................................................................

7%


We have had a lot of stress over the last few months and I really expected it to be higher - so very pleased with this.🙂Bev


p.s. This puts us in the top 16% of paediatric hba1c results in the Country.
